Abstract

acionamento autônomo de retransmissão de dados. aparelhos, métodos e sistemas são divulgados para duplicação e retransmissão autônomas de pacotes. um aparelho 600 inclui um processador 605 que gera 805 uma primeira pdu para uma primeira concessão de enlace ascendente associada a um primeiro processo harq e gera 810 uma segunda mac pdu para uma segunda concessão de enlace ascendente associada a um segundo processo harq. aqui, a primeira concessão de enlace ascendente é uma concessão configurada, a segunda concessão de enlace ascendente tem recursos pusch sobrepostos com a primeira concessão de enlace ascendente e a segunda concessão de enlace ascendente tem uma prioridade mais alta do que a primeira concessão de enlace ascendente. o aparelho 600 inclui um transceptor 625 que transmite 815 a segunda mac pdu de acordo com a segunda concessão de enlace ascendente e não transmite a primeira mac pdu de acordo com a primeira concessão de enlace ascendente. o processador 605 aciona 820 autonomamente uma retransmissão da primeira mac pdu para o primeiro processo harq sem receber sinalização de rede para a retransmissão.
